How many lumens are most car headlights?

What is the standard amount of lumens for a car’s headlights? I need to buy new ones, and I have no idea how strong they should be! Does the strength vary from car to car, or is the decision more about the owner’s preference?

avatar
Joshua Levy · Updated on
Reviewed by Shannon Martin, Licensed Insurance Agent.
Figuring out which parts you need for your car is tricky because the headlight aisle is packed with an endless sea of options! However, you essentially have three options with various lumens, or brightness:
  • Halogen headlights: 700 to 1,200 lumens
  • High-intensity discharge (HID) headlights: 3,000 to 5,500 lumens
  • LED headlights: 3,000 to 6,000 lumens
While dimmer, halogen headlights are far less expensive. HID and LED headlights offer much more brightness, but the added lumens come at a premium at the checkout counter.
Check your owner’s manual for any headlight specifications before you settle on your new bulbs. Your headlights are important for maintaining visibility at night, and using bulbs that aren’t bright enough for your vehicle is dangerous.
